Custom Sizing for Irregularly Shaped Paint Bucket Gaskets

When dealing with paint buckets that have non – standard or irregular shapes, finding the right gasket size becomes a crucial task. A well – fitted gasket ensures a tight seal, preventing paint leakage and maintaining the quality of the stored product. This article explores the key aspects of custom sizing for irregularly shaped paint bucket gaskets.

Understanding Irregular Shapes in Paint Buckets

Paint buckets can come in a variety of irregular shapes for different reasons. Some may be designed with ergonomic features, such as contoured handles or unique body profiles, to enhance user experience. Others might have specialized shapes to fit specific storage or transportation requirements. These irregularities pose challenges when it comes to selecting or creating a suitable gasket.

Common Irregular Features

One common irregular feature is an asymmetrical body. This means that the paint bucket does not have a uniform shape around its circumference. For example, one side might be slightly wider or have a different curvature compared to the other. Another feature could be the presence of protrusions or indentations on the rim or body of the bucket. These can be used for functions like locking mechanisms or for attaching additional components.

Impact on Gasket Selection

The irregular shape directly affects the gasket’s ability to form a proper seal. A standard, off – the – shelf gasket may not fit snugly around an asymmetrical rim or may not be able to accommodate protrusions. This can lead to gaps between the gasket and the bucket surface, allowing paint to seep out. Therefore, custom sizing becomes essential to ensure an effective seal.

Measuring for Custom Gaskets

Accurate measurement is the foundation of creating a custom – sized gasket for an irregularly shaped paint bucket. Here are the key steps involved in the measurement process.

Outer Rim Measurement

Start by measuring the outer rim of the paint bucket. Use a flexible measuring tape to follow the contour of the rim precisely. If the rim has an irregular shape, take multiple measurements at different points around the circumference. Record the largest and smallest diameters or circumferences to get an overall understanding of the rim’s size variations.

Inner Rim Measurement

Next, measure the inner rim of the bucket. This is the area where the gasket will actually make contact with the bucket to form a seal. Similar to the outer rim measurement, use a flexible tape and take multiple readings if the inner rim is irregular. Pay attention to any indentations or protrusions within the inner rim area, as these will need to be accounted for in the gasket design.

Depth Measurement

Measure the depth of the area where the gasket will be placed. This is important to ensure that the gasket has the right thickness to fit properly and provide an adequate seal. If the depth varies across the rim, note these variations as well.

Design Considerations for Custom Gaskets

Once the measurements are taken, the next step is to design a gasket that fits the irregularly shaped paint bucket perfectly. There are several design considerations to keep in mind.

Material Flexibility

Choose a gasket material that has sufficient flexibility to conform to the irregular shape of the bucket. Rubber and silicone are popular choices as they can stretch and bend to fit around curves and accommodate protrusions. The material should also be able to maintain its shape over time and under different environmental conditions, such as temperature changes and exposure to paint chemicals.

Seal Design

The design of the seal itself is crucial. For an irregularly shaped bucket, a simple flat gasket may not be sufficient. Consider using a gasket with a specialized seal design, such as a beaded seal or a multi – lip seal. These designs can provide better contact with the bucket surface and enhance the sealing performance, especially in areas with irregularities.

Tolerance and Fit

Account for tolerances in the design. Since the bucket may have slight variations in its shape due to manufacturing processes, the gasket should be designed with a small amount of tolerance to ensure a proper fit. However, the tolerance should not be so large that it compromises the seal. A snug fit is essential, but it should also allow for easy installation and removal of the gasket.

In conclusion, custom sizing for irregularly shaped paint bucket gaskets requires a thorough understanding of the bucket’s shape, accurate measurement techniques, and careful design considerations. By taking these factors into account, it is possible to create a gasket that provides a reliable and long – lasting seal for the paint bucket.
